Output e81dfad24da53d0cf0a4c9787f018e0a800c1195b31b8ab40695386c2e783ac0:108

value
7591161
script pubkey
OP_0 OP_PUSHBYTES_20 e44b526dd07af1394d7ae3975bcc1046e8f46054
address
bc1qu394ymws0tcnjnt6uwt4hnqsgm50gcz5gw4zjw
transaction
e81dfad24da53d0cf0a4c9787f018e0a800c1195b31b8ab40695386c2e783ac0
spent
false

97 Sat Ranges